Appleton Post Crescent
Sat., Jul. 2, 1966 pg. B3

Mrs. Lena Conrad
1011 Kenneth Ave., Kaukauna

Age 85, passed away Friday evening. She was born November 11, 1880 in the Town of Osborne, and had been a resident of Kaukauna since 1917. She was a member of St. Mary's Altar Society. Mrs. Conrad is survived by five daughters, Mrs. Nick (Annacel) Milbach Sr., Mrs. Dean (Frances) Ozburn and Mrs. Henry (Marie) Jansen, all of Kaukauna, Mrs. Martha Scholz and Mrs. C. J. (Margaret) Van Himbergen, both of Kimberly; six sons, Joseph, Wenzel, Leonard, Peter and Leo all of Kaukauna; Sylvester, Sturgeon Bay; seven sisters, Mrs. Anna Gilkey, Mrs. Alfred (Theresa) Vande Hey, Mrs. Josephine Siebers and Mrs. Frank (Frances) Siebers all of Kaukauna; Mrs. Richard (Mary) Moehring, Seymour; Mrs. Elizabeth Crosby and Mrs. William (Martha) Weyenberg, both of Appleton; 31 grandchildren and 45 great-grandchildren. Funeral services will be held at 10 a.m. Tuesday at St. Mary's Catholic Church, Kaukauna with the Rt. Rev. Msgr. Peter A. Salm officiating. Burial will be in the parish cemetery. Friends may call at the Greenwood Funeral Home, Kaukauna after 2 p.m. Monday. Rosary will be prayed at 7 p.m. by the Altar Society and general rosary at 8 p.m. Monday at the funeral home.
